In this Cloud-Native Artificial Intelligence for Water Rights certificate program, we focus on roles that merge AI, data science, cloud technologies, and water rights management. The UK job market is actively seeking professionals with these combined skillsets for various positions. Let's delve into the specific roles and their relevance in this emerging field, as represented in the above 3D pie chart. 1. **AI Engineer in Water Industry**: These professionals design, develop, and implement AI solutions tailored for the water industry. They require domain-specific knowledge and strong AI skills to address challenges in water management and conservation. 2. **Data Scientist for Water Rights**: Data scientists in this domain focus on extracting insights from water rights-related datasets. They apply machine learning techniques, statistical models, and data visualization tools to make informed decisions in water distribution, pricing, and policy-making. 3. **Cloud Architect for Water Management**: Cloud architects specializing in water management are responsible for designing and implementing cloud-based infrastructure for storing, processing, and analyzing water-related data. They help organizations transition from on-premises systems to more scalable and cost-effective cloud solutions. 4. **Water Rights Specialist with AI skills**: These professionals combine domain expertise in water rights with AI capabilities, enabling them to analyze legal agreements, monitor compliance, and detect potential fraud or mismanagement in water distribution systems. 5. **Machine Learning Engineer in Utilities**: Machine learning engineers in the utilities sector leverage advanced algorithms and models to optimize energy consumption, demand forecasting, and infrastructure maintenance. They help utility companies improve efficiency, reduce costs, and enhance customer satisfaction. These roles highlight the growing demand for professionals skilled in cloud-native AI technologies and water rights management.
